Introduction:

Poker is a classic card game which involves a mix of ability, strategy, and fortune. A critical facet of the online game is gambling, which adds a fantastic element and will somewhat influence the outcome of a hand. This report is designed to supply a thorough summary of poker wagering, including crucial strategies, guidelines, and best techniques to enhance players' gameplay while increasing their odds of winning.

Breakdown of Poker Betting:

Poker wagering is the act of placing wagers through the different stages of a hand. It's typically started because of the player left of dealership, additionally the wagering continues clockwise around the dining table. The main purpose of gambling in poker is always to win the cooking pot, containing all of the chips or cash wagered by the people. The scale and time of wagers are crucial in influencing opponents' decisions and eventually identifying the outcome of a hand.

Approaches for Poker Betting:

1. give Analysis: Before placing a bet, it is important to evaluate the potency of your hand. Evaluate aspects just like the quality of your cards, their particular prospective to enhance, and their particular relative energy compared to the neighborhood cards (in Texas Hold'em). Adjust your betting correctly, placing bigger wagers with more powerful arms and smaller wagers with limited holdings.

2. Position: consider carefully your seating place at table whenever deciding exactly how much to wager. Being in a belated place lets you gather extra information regarding the opponents' gambling patterns, enabling you to make more well-informed decisions. Aggressive wagering and bluffing tend to be more effective in late opportunities, as opponents have already expressed their opinions regarding the energy of the fingers.

3. Bet Sizing: Properly sizing your wagers is crucial. Avoid making predictable bets or always wagering similar quantity, as observant opponents can exploit this. Vary your wager sizes on the basis of the power of hand, modifying it to produce a balance between extracting value and avoiding losings. In addition, look at the pot chances and potential of hand to improve when selecting bet size.

Guidelines and greatest Methods:

1. learning Opponents: Pay close attention to the gambling patterns, gestures, and verbal cues of the opponents. These could supply important ideas to their holdings which help you will be making much better decisions. Try to find any deviations from their particular standard behavior, which could show weakness or energy.

2. Bluffing: Bluffing is an essential part of poker betting. The objective will be make opponents think that you've got a stronger hand than you truly do. Bluff selectively and give consideration to factors like the board texture, your dining table image, and your opponents' tendencies. Keep in mind, successful bluffing requires a good understanding of your opponents' playing designs.

3. Bankroll control: Effective bankroll management is essential to sustaining long-term success in poker. Determine a budget for the poker sessions and prevent putting bets beyond your means. Develop control and give a wide berth to chasing losses or making impulsive big wagers might compromise your money.
